The Alberta Workers Association for Research and Education (AWARE) strives to provide a research and educational space where workers support workers across industries, identities, and immigration status.​

What we do

AWARE aims to empower workers through research, education, and community building. 

 

We focus primarily on supporting workers with precarious immigration status as they are most vulnerable to exploitation and abuse. â€‹

Edmonton Resource Toolkit

A compilation of resources for precarious workers and the organizations that provide support. Recognizing that undocumented workers, or others with precarious immigration status, often face barriers in accessing services and support, the toolkit includes contact information for service providers, highlighting those services that do not require immigration documents to access. The toolkit also includes additional information, research, and analysis aimed at empowering workers.
